16.505 Definitions for KRS 16.505 to 16.652. As used in KRS 16.505 to 16.652, unless the context otherwise requires:
(1) "System" means the State Police Retirement System created by KRS 16.505 to 16.652; (2) "Board" means the board of trustees of the Kentucky Retirement Systems;
(3) "Employer" or "State Police" means the Department of Kentucky State Police, or its successor; (4) "Current service" means the number of years and completed months of employment as an employee subsequent to July 1, 1958, for which creditable compensation was
paid by the employer and employee contributions deducted except as otherwise
provided; (5) "Prior service" means the number of years and completed months of employment as an employee prior to July 1, 1958, for which creditable compensation was paid to
the employee by the Commonwealth. Twelve (12) months of current service in the
system are required to validate prior service; (6) "Service" means the total of current service and prior service;
(7) "Accumulated contributions" at any time means the sum of all amounts deducted from the compensation of a member and credited to his individual account in the
member's contribution account, including employee contributions picked up after
August 1, 1982, pursuant to KRS 16.545(4), together with interest credited on such
amounts as provided in KRS 16.505 to 16.652, and any other amounts the member
shall have contributed, including interest credited. For members who begin
participating on or after September 1, 2008, "accumulated contributions" shall not
include employee contributions that are deposited into accounts established
pursuant to 26 U.S.C. sec. 401(h) within the funds established in KRS 16.510,
61.515, and 78.520, as prescribed by KRS 61.702(2)(b); (8) "Creditable compensation" means all salary and wages, including payments for compensatory time, paid to the employee as a result of services performed for the
employer or for time during which the member is on paid leave, which are
includable on the member's federal form W-2 wage and tax statement under the
heading "wages, tips, other compensation," including employee contributions
picked up after August 1, 1982, pursuant to KRS 16.545(4). A lump-sum bonus,
severance pay, or employer-provided payment for purchase of service credit shall be
included as creditable compensation but shall be averaged over the employee's total
service with the system in which it is recorded if it is equal to or greater than one
thousand dollars ($1,000). Living allowances, expense reimbursements, lump-sum
payments for accrued vacation leave, and other items determined by the board shall
be excluded. Creditable compensation shall also include amounts which are not
includable in the member's gross income by virtue of the member having taken a
voluntary salary reduction provided for under applicable provisions of the Internal
Revenue Code. Creditable compensation shall also include elective amounts for
qualified transportation fringes paid or made available on or after January 1, 2001,
for calendar years on or after January 1, 2001, that are not includable in the gross income of the employee by reason of 26 U.S.C. sec. 132(f)(4). For employees who
begin participating on or after September 1, 2008, creditable compensation shall not
include payments for compensatory time; (9) "Final compensation" means: (a) For a member who begins participating before September 1, 2008, the creditable compensation of a member during the three (3) fiscal years he was
paid at the highest average monthly rate divided by the number of months of
service credit during the three (3) year period, multiplied by twelve (12); the
three (3) years may be fractional and need not be consecutive. If the number of
months of service credit during the three (3) year period is less than twenty-
four (24), one (1) or more additional fiscal years shall be used; or (b) For a member who begins participating on or after September 1, 2008, the creditable compensation of the member during the three (3) complete fiscal
years he or she was paid at the highest average monthly rate divided by three
(3). Each fiscal year used to determine final compensation must contain
twelve (12) months of service credit; (10) "Final rate of pay" means the actual rate upon which earnings of a member were calculated during the twelve (12) month period immediately preceding the
member's effective retirement date, including employee contributions picked up
after August 1, 1982, pursuant to KRS 16.545(4). The rate shall be certified to the
system by the employer and the following equivalents shall be used to convert the
rate to an annual rate: two thousand eighty (2,080) hours for eight (8) hour
workdays, one thousand nine hundred fifty (1,950) hours for seven and one-half (7-
1/2) hour workdays, two hundred sixty (260) days, fifty-two (52) weeks, twelve (12)
months, or one (1) year; (11) "Retired member" means any former member receiving a retirement allowance or any former member who has filed the necessary documents for retirement benefits
and is no longer contributing to the retirement system; (12) "Retirement allowance" means the retirement payments to which a retired member is entitled; (13) "Actuarial equivalent" means a benefit of equal value when computed upon the basis of actuarial tables adopted by the board. In cases of disability retirement, the
options authorized by KRS 61.635 shall be computed by adding ten (10) years to
the age of the member, unless the member has chosen the Social Security
adjustment option as provided for in KRS 61.635(8), in which case the member's
actual age shall be used. No disability retirement option shall be less than the same
option computed under early retirement; (14) "Authorized leave of absence" means any time during which a person is absent from employment but retained in the status of an employee in accordance with the
personnel policy of the Department of Kentucky State Police; (15) "Normal retirement date" means: (a) For a member who begins participating before September 1, 2008, the first day of the month following a member's fifty-fifth birthday, except that for members over age fifty-five (55) on July 1, 1958, it shall mean January 1,
1959; or (b) For a member who begins participating on or after September 1, 2008, the first day of the month following a member's sixtieth birthday; (16) "Disability retirement date" means the first day of the month following the last day of paid employment; (17) "Dependent child" means a child in the womb and a natural or legally adopted child of the member who has neither attained age eighteen (18) nor married or who is an
unmarried full-time student who has not attained age twenty-two (22); (18) "Optional allowance" means an actuarially equivalent benefit elected by the member in lieu of all other benefits provided by KRS 16.505 to 16.652; (19) "Act in line of duty" means an act occurring or a thing done, which, as determined by the board, was required in the performance of the duties specified in KRS
16.060. For employees in hazardous positions under KRS 61.592, an "act in line of
duty" shall mean an act occurring which was required in the performance of the
principal duties of the position as defined by the job description; (20) "Early retirement date" means: (a) For a member who begins participating before September 1, 2008, the retirement date declared by a member who is not less than fifty (50) years of
age and has fifteen (15) years of service; or (b) For a member who begins participating on or after September 1, 2008, the retirement date declared by a member who is not less than fifty (50) years of
age and has fifteen (15) years of service credited under KRS 16.543(1),
61.543(1), or 78.615(1) or another state-administered retirement system; (21) "Member" means any officer included in the membership of the system as provided under KRS 16.520 whose membership has not been terminated under KRS 61.535; (22) "Regular full-time officers" means the occupants of positions as set forth in KRS 16.010; (23) "Hazardous disability" as used in KRS 16.505 to 16.652 means a disability which results in an employee's total incapacity to continue as an employee in a hazardous
position, but the employee is not necessarily deemed to be totally and permanently
disabled to engage in other occupations for remuneration or profit; (24) "Current rate of pay" means the member's actual hourly, daily, weekly, biweekly, monthly, or yearly rate of pay converted to an annual rate as defined in final rate of
pay. The rate shall be certified by the employer; (25) "Beneficiary" means the person, persons, estate, trust, or trustee designated by the member in accordance with KRS 61.542 or 61.705 to receive any available benefits
in the event of the member's death. As used in KRS 61.702, "beneficiary" does not
mean an estate, trust, or trustee; (26) "Recipient" means the retired member, the person or persons designated as beneficiary by the member and drawing a retirement allowance as a result of the
member's death, or a dependent child drawing a retirement allowance. An alternate payee of a qualified domestic relations order shall not be considered a recipient,
except for purposes of KRS 61.623; (27) "Person" means a natural person;
(28) "Retirement office" means the Kentucky Retirement Systems office building in Frankfort; (29) "Delayed contribution payment" means an amount paid by an employee for purchase of current service. The amount shall be determined using the same formula
in KRS 61.5525, and the payment shall not be picked up by the employer. A
delayed contribution payment shall be deposited to the member's contribution
account and considered as accumulated contributions of the individual member; (30) "Last day of paid employment" means the last date employer and employee contributions are required to be reported in accordance with KRS 16.543, 61.543, or
78.615 to the retirement office in order for the employee to receive current service
credit for the month. Last day of paid employment does not mean a date the
employee receives payment for accrued leave, whether by lump sum or otherwise, if
that date occurs twenty-four (24) or more months after previous contributions; (31) "Objective medical evidence" means reports of examinations or treatments; medical signs which are anatomical, physiological, or psychological abnormalities that can
be observed; psychiatric signs which are medically demonstrable phenomena
indicating specific abnormalities of behavior, affect, thought, memory, orientation,
or contact with reality; or laboratory findings which are anatomical, physiological,
or psychological phenomena that can be shown by medically acceptable laboratory
diagnostic techniques, including but not limited to chemical tests,
electrocardiograms, electroencephalograms, X-rays, and psychological tests; (32) "Fiscal year" of the system means the twelve (12) months from July 1 through the following June 30, which shall also be the plan year. The "fiscal year" shall be the
limitation year used to determine contribution and benefit limits established by 26
U.S.C. sec. 415; (33) "Participating" means an employee is currently earning service credit in the system as provided in KRS 16.543; (34) "Month" means a calendar month;
(35) "Membership date" means the date upon which the member began participating in the system as provided by KRS 16.543; (36) "Participant" means a member, as defined by subsection (21) of this section, or a retired member, as defined by subsection (11) of this section; (37) "Qualified domestic relations order" means any judgment, decree, or order, including approval of a property settlement agreement, that:
(a) Is issued by a court or administrative agency; and
(b) Relates to the provision of child support, alimony payments, or marital property rights to an alternate payee; and (38) "Alternate payee" means a spouse, former spouse, child, or other dependent of a participant, who is designated to be paid retirement benefits in a qualified domestic
relations order. Effective: July 15, 2010
